Step 1: Learn the Core Skills (1-2 Months)
To become a data analyst quickly, focus on the most essential skills that hiring managers look for.
1. Python for Data Analysis (AI-Assisted Learning)
Use ChatGPT or GitHub Copilot to generate Python scripts for data manipulation.
Learn pandas, NumPy, Matplotlib, seaborn for data analysis and visualization.
Try DataCamp’s AI-powered Python tutor for interactive learning.
🔹 AI Shortcut: Use ChatGPT’s code interpreter to debug and optimize your Python scripts instantly.
2. SQL for Data Extraction & Manipulation
Learn basic queries, joins, aggregations, and subqueries.
Use AI-powered SQL generators like AI2SQL to speed up query writing.
Practice on Kaggle datasets or SQLZoo.
🔹 AI Shortcut: ChatGPT + SQL AI Assistants can suggest the best SQL queries for real-world scenarios.
3. Data Visualization & BI Tools
Learn Tableau or Power BI for dashboards.
Use AI-driven insights in Power BI to find patterns in data.
Automate reports using Google Looker Studio + AI.
🔹 AI Shortcut: AI-powered Tableau & Power BI can suggest best chart types and insights automatically.
4. Statistics & Business Understanding
Learn descriptive stats, probability, hypothesis testing.
AI-based courses like Khan Academy’s AI tutor can help with problem-solving.
Read case studies on real-world data analysis.
🔹 AI Shortcut: Use ChatGPT to explain statistics concepts in simple terms with examples.

Step 2: Build Real-World Projects (1-2 Months)
Projects showcase your practical skills to recruiters. Use AI to build faster!
1. Exploratory Data Analysis (EDA) on Real Datasets
Choose a dataset from Kaggle and analyze it using pandas + seaborn.
Let AI generate automatic insights using ChatGPT or PandasAI.
Document your findings in a Jupyter Notebook.
2. SQL-Based Data Analysis
Work on Google BigQuery datasets.
Use AI-powered SQL to generate complex queries.
3. Build an AI-Powered Dashboard
Use Power BI + AI to generate auto-insights.
Create a dashboard on stock market trends or sales data.
🔹 AI Shortcut: Use AI AutoML in Power BI to find predictive trends.
4. Automate Data Cleaning with AI
Use OpenAI's PandasAI to auto-clean messy data.
Automate missing value imputation using AI-based imputation methods.
